Changeset 30 for trunk


Ignore:
Timestamp:
01/25/11 17:10:03 (13 years ago)
Author:
Kris Deugau
Message:

/trunk/dnsbl

Commit added entries in IP skiplist

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dnsbl/extract-data

    r21 r30  
    9191# put together an array of netblocks we won't/can't list for various reasons
    9292my @dontlistme = (
    93     # Hotmail/Windows Live Mail
     93    # Microsoft/Hotmail/Windows Live Mail
    9494#IP-Network                    207.68.128.0/18
    9595#IP-Network                    207.68.192.0/20
     
    9797        NetAddr::IP->new("65.52.0.0/14"),
    9898        NetAddr::IP->new("207.68.176.96/27"),
     99#IP-Network                    157.54.0.0/15
     100#IP-Network                    157.56.0.0/14
     101#IP-Network                    157.60.0.0/16
     102        NetAddr::IP->new("157.55.0.192/27"),
     103        NetAddr::IP->new("157.55.0.225"),
     104        NetAddr::IP->new("157.55.0.226"),
     105#IP-Network                    207.46.0.0/16
     106        NetAddr::IP->new("207.46.66.0/28"),
    99107
    100108    # AOL - note only some IPs show mail-ish rDNS
    101109    #IP-Network                    205.188.0.0/16
    102110    #IP-Network                    64.12.0.0/16
    103         NetAddr::IP->new("205.188.91.96/29"),
    104         NetAddr::IP->new("205.188.105.143"),
    105         NetAddr::IP->new("205.188.105.144/30"),
    106         NetAddr::IP->new("205.188.169.196/29"),
    107         NetAddr::IP->new("205.188.249.128/29"),
    108         NetAddr::IP->new("205.188.249.64/29"),
    109111        NetAddr::IP->new("64.12.78.136/30"),
    110112        NetAddr::IP->new("64.12.78.142"),
     113        NetAddr::IP->new("64.12.100.31"),
    111114        NetAddr::IP->new("64.12.143.144/30"),
    112115        NetAddr::IP->new("64.12.143.152/30"),
     
    119122        NetAddr::IP->new("64.12.207.176/29"),
    120123    #IP-Network                    205.188.0.0/16
     124        NetAddr::IP->new("205.188.91.94/31"),
     125        NetAddr::IP->new("205.188.91.96/31"),
     126        NetAddr::IP->new("205.188.105.143"),
     127        NetAddr::IP->new("205.188.105.144/30"),
     128        NetAddr::IP->new("205.188.169.196/29"),
     129        NetAddr::IP->new("205.188.249.128/29"),
     130        NetAddr::IP->new("205.188.249.64/29"),
    121131        NetAddr::IP->new("205.188.169.200/23"),
    122132
     
    158168#route:          116.214.0.0/20
    159169        NetAddr::IP->new("116.214.12.0/24"),
     170        NetAddr::IP->new("202.86.4.0/22"),
     171        NetAddr::IP->new("77.238.188/23"),
     172        NetAddr::IP->new("217.146.182.0/23"),
     173        NetAddr::IP->new("114.111.64.0/18"),
     174        NetAddr::IP->new("115.178.12.0/23"),
     175        NetAddr::IP->new("121.101.151.212"),
     176#inetnum:      121.101.144.0 - 121.101.159.255
     177        NetAddr::IP->new("121.101.144.0/20"),
     178        NetAddr::IP->new("66.94.224.0/19"),
     179        NetAddr::IP->new("203.104.16.0/21"),
    160180
    161181    # MessageLabs - may add these to trusted_networks instead
     
    163183# observed: .35, .51
    164184        NetAddr::IP->new("194.106.220.0/23"),
     185        NetAddr::IP->new("193.109.254.0/23"),
     186        NetAddr::IP->new("119.161.0.0/19"),
     187# buh? rDNS says Yahoo, but...
     188#inetnum:        203.209.224.0 - 203.209.255.255
     189#descr:          Alibaba (Beijing) Technology Co., Ltd.
     190        NetAddr::IP->new("203.209.230.22"),
    165191
    166192    # Bell Canada - note only some IPs show mail-ish rDNS
     
    200226    #IP-Network                    24.222.0.0/16
    201227        NetAddr::IP->new("24.222.0.30"),
    202         NetAddr::IP->new("24.224.136.8/30"),
     228        NetAddr::IP->new("24.224.136.0/27"),
    203229
    204230    # Cogeco - only a few IPs observed with mail-ish rDNS
    205231    #IP-Network                    216.221.64.0/19
    206232        NetAddr::IP->new("216.221.81.192"),
     233        NetAddr::IP->new("216.221.81.25"),
    207234        NetAddr::IP->new("216.221.81.28/30"),
    208235        NetAddr::IP->new("216.221.81.96/30"),
     
    223250    #inetnum:      61.9.128.0 - 61.9.255.255
    224251    # may miss one or two
     252        # .168.135-152
    225253        NetAddr::IP->new("61.9.168.136/29"),
    226254        NetAddr::IP->new("61.9.168.144/29"),
     255        # .189.132-152
     256        NetAddr::IP->new("61.9.189.132/30"),
     257        NetAddr::IP->new("61.9.189.136/29"),
     258        NetAddr::IP->new("61.9.189.144/29"),
     259    # "TelestraClear" - related to above?
     260    #inetnum:      203.97.0.0 - 203.97.127.255
     261        NetAddr::IP->new("203.97.33.64"),
     262        NetAddr::IP->new("203.97.33.68"),
     263        NetAddr::IP->new("203.97.37.64"),
     264
     265    # Earthlink
     266    #IP-Network                    207.69.0.0/16
     267        NetAddr::IP->new("207.69.200.28"),
     268
     269    # Sprint
     270    #IP-Network                    68.24.0.0/13
     271        # actually their PCS mail relay, so sez rDNS
     272        NetAddr::IP->new("68.28.27.84"),
     273
     274    # Vodafone (New Zealand)
     275    # inetnum:        203.109.128.0 - 203.109.159.255
     276        NetAddr::IP->new("203.109.136/28"),
    227277
    228278## Edumactional places
     
    242292    # University of Florida
    243293    #IP-Network                    128.227.0.0/16
     294        NetAddr::IP->new("128.227.74.70"),
    244295        NetAddr::IP->new("128.227.74.149"),
    245296        NetAddr::IP->new("128.227.74.165"),
     
    290341    #IP-Network                    199.111.64.0/19
    291342        NetAddr::IP->new("199.111.84.18"),
     343
     344    #inetnum:        130.95.0.0 - 130.95.255.255
     345    #address:        The University of Western Australia
     346        NetAddr::IP->new("130.95.3.211"),
     347
     348    #inetnum:      130.56.0.0 - 130.56.255.255
     349    #address:      IIS, Australian National University
     350        NetAddr::IP->new("130.56.64.134"),
     351
     352    #IP-Network                    129.81.0.0/16
     353    #Org-Name                      Tulane University
     354        NetAddr::IP->new("129.81.224.84"),
    292355
    293356# List servers
     
    310373    #IP-Network                    72.167.0.0/16
    311374        NetAddr::IP->new("72.167.82.80/29"),
     375        NetAddr::IP->new("72.167.82.90"),
    312376    #IP-Network                    173.201.0.0/16
    313377        NetAddr::IP->new("173.201.192.0/24"),
     378
     379    # EmailBrain - note no actual netblocks of their own.  :(
     380        NetAddr::IP->new("66.100.171.162"),
     381#163.171.100.66.in-addr.arpa domain name pointer eb08.ebhost9.com.
     382#164.171.100.66.in-addr.arpa domain name pointer a.eb08.ebhost9.com.
     383#165.171.100.66.in-addr.arpa domain name pointer b.eb08.ebhost9.com.
     384#166.171.100.66.in-addr.arpa domain name pointer c.eb08.ebhost9.com.
     385
     386
     387# eBay/PayPal
     388        NetAddr::IP->new("66.211.160.0/19"),
     389
     390# Misc legit
     391    # Texas Instruments
     392    #IP-Network                    192.94.94.0/24
     393        NetAddr::IP->new("192.94.94.40"),
    314394
    315395    ); # done def for @dontlistme
     
    404484}
    405485foreach my $uri (sort keys %urilist) {
    406   my @hout = qx { host '$uri.multi.uribl.com'; host '$uri.uribl.company.com' };
     486  my @hout = qx { host '$uri.multi.uribl.com'; host '$uri.company.dnsbl.' };
    407487  if ($hout[0] =~ /NXDOMAIN/ && $hout[1] =~ /NXDOMAIN/) {
    408488    if ($opts{u}) {
Note: See TracChangeset for help on using the changeset viewer.